SEO MATCH SUMMARY

The Atlanta Hawks defeated the Cleveland Cavaliers 130–123 on November 28 at State Farm Arena, with N. Alexander-Walker and J. Johnson combining for 59 points to lead the home offense. Alexander-Walker scored 30 and Johnson added 29 as Atlanta shot 52.7 percent from the field and made 16 three-pointers, while maintaining a 119.9 offensive rating despite 12 turnovers. Cleveland's Donovan Mitchell posted 42 points in a losing effort, supported by E. Mobley's 20, but the Cavaliers' 46.3 field-goal percentage and 17 turnovers proved costly. The game finished under the 236.5 Vegas total, with Atlanta's third quarter (37 points) proving decisive in building separation. Cleveland's rebounding advantage (48 to 38) and second-quarter explosion (39 points) kept the contest competitive, yet the Hawks' balanced scoring and defensive execution—holding Cleveland to a 115.2 offensive rating—secured the seven-point victory. The result puts Atlanta in a stronger position within the Eastern Conference standings.
